#6a7400 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6a7400 is composed of 41.6% red, 45.5%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 8.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 54.5% black. It has a hue angle of 65.2 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 22.7%. #6a7400 color hex could be obtained by blending #d4e800 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

Shades and Tints of #6a7400

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#101200 is the darkest color, while #fffffd is the lightest one.

Tones of #6a7400

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3e3e36 is the less saturated color, while #6a7400 is the most saturated one.
